Whiskey: Edradour 10 Year Old 2013 Cask #155 New Vibrations Single Malt Scotch Whisky | 700ML
An Edradour single malt, distilled on 15 March 2013 and aged for a decade in a single first-fill sherry butt (#155). On 6 July 2023, 681 bottles were filled at 59.6% ABV for the New Vibrations series by La Maison du Whisky.

Distillery Information
The story of Edradour and the Distillery is intimately caught up in the dramatic history of the development of Scotch whisky. Before whisky became synonymous with Scotland, respected and prized throughout the globe, it was produced on a small scale in pot stills and illegally, mostly in the Highlands.
